How many countries are in NC?

The U.S. state of North Carolina is divided into 100 counties. North Carolina ranks 28th in size by area, but has the seventh-highest number of counties in the country.

Why are North Carolina called Tarheels?

Tar Heel is a nickname applied to the U.S. state of North Carolina. One such legend claims it to be a nickname given during the U.S. Civil War, because of the state’s importance on the Confederate side, and the fact that the troops “stuck to their ranks like they had tar on their heels”.

What does first in freedom mean in NC?

About the ‘First in Freedom’ Plate. Designed by license plate collector and North Carolina historian Charles Robinson, the “First in Freedom” plate design recognizes two important events: the signing of the Mecklenburg Declaration of Independence on May 20, 1775, and the Halifax Resolves on April 12, 1776.

What city in North Carolina has the lowest crime rate?

Holly Springs is the safest city in the state with a safety score of 89.19 and a population of 31,640. It has experienced a 14.6% decline in its already low violent crime rates. It is located in the southwest suburbs of Raleigh, the state capital.

What is the life expectancy in North Carolina?

North Carolina has the 39th-highest life expectancy among all U.S. states (77.8 years). The top 10 U.S. states and territories by life expectancy are: Hawaii, Minnesota, Puerto Rico, Connecticut, California, Massachusetts, New York, Vermont, New Hampshire, New Jersey.

Does it snow in North Carolina?

Snow in North Carolina is seen on a regular basis in the mountains. North Carolina averages 5 inches (130 mm) of snow a year. However, this also varies greatly across the state.

How many miles across is North Carolina?

North Carolina covers 53,821 square miles (139,396 km2) and is 503 miles (810 km) long by 150 miles (241 km) wide.
